[2] The Safeway Multiple Employer Retirement Plan (“SMERP”) is a multiple employer plan as defined in the Internal Revenue Code. However, the SMERP is characterized as a multiemployer plan by the FASB, even though it is not maintained pursuant to any collective bargaining agreements to which Safeway is party. The plan may be subject to statutory annual minimum contributions based on complex actuarial calculations. Additionally, it has no PPA zone status and is not subject to establishment of a funding improvement plan or a rehabilitation plan or other PPA provisions that apply to multiemployer plans.
